A. The Property Maintenance Code of the City
of Wildwood may be enforced pursuant to the terms of a contractual
arrangement entered into between the City of Wildwood and St. Louis
County.
B. The St. Louis County Property Maintenance
Code, as amended by the County of Saint Louis, Missouri, i.e., Property
Maintenance—not including the Residential Reoccupancy Inspection
Requirements (County Ordinance No. 22,316—adopted on May 18,
2005, Ordinance No. 24,440— adopted July 14, 2010), is hereby
respectively adopted as the Property Maintenance Code of the City
of Wildwood, Missouri, as if fully set forth herein and shall be enforced
by the City and its contractual agents as the applicable code, except
as may otherwise conflict with Wildwood City Codes.

A. The following Sections of the Property
Maintenance Code are deleted and substituted and adopted as follows:
1.
1110.020. Scope. The provisions of
this Code shall be effective in all areas within the City of Wildwood.
2.
1110.030. Property Maintenance Code
Adopted. Certain documents, three (3) copies of which were placed
on file in the Office of the Director of Public Works and the Administrative
Director of the County Council, said copies being marked and designated
as the BOCA National Property Maintenance Code, 1990, Third Edition,
as published by the Building Officials and Code Administrators International,
Inc., be and is hereby adopted as the Property Maintenance Code of
Wildwood, Missouri, for the control of property, building and structures
as herein provided; and each and all of the regulations, provisions,
penalties conditions, and terms of the BOCA National Property Maintenance
Code, 1990, Third Edition, are hereby referred to, adopted and made
a part hereof, as if fully set out in this Article, with the additions,
insertions, deletions, and changes, prescribed in this Article.
3.
1101.020. Jurisdictional Titles.
Throughout the BOCA National Property Maintenance Code, 1990, Third
Edition, wherever the terms "Name of Jurisdiction" or "Local Jurisdiction"
appear it shall be deemed to mean "St. Louis County, Missouri" or
"City of Wildwood." Likewise wherever the term "Department of Building
Inspection" appears it shall be deemed to mean "Department of Public
Works or its designee." Wherever the term "Code" appears it shall
mean the BOCA National Property Maintenance Code, 1990, as adopted
herein.
